  • Overview

    Universal Design for Learning is the best way to teach all students effectively—but how can a busy teacher get started with UDL right now? Answers are in this vibrant, research-based guidebook, created by seasoned teacher and former UDL Coordinator Loui Lord Nelson. K-12 educators will learn how to use the three key principles of UDL—Engagement, Representation, and Action & Expression—to present information in multiple ways and meet the needs of diverse learners. Written in first person, like a face-to-face talk with a passionate educator, the book gives teachers a reader-friendly UDL primer and a practical framework for implementation, with detailed guidelines on lesson planning and checkpoints that help them stay on track.


    USE UDL PRINCIPLES TO HELP STUDENTS:
    • sharpen executive function skills, such as goal-setting and strategy development
    • improve comprehension and information processing
    • stay engaged during lessons and overcome distractions
    • communicate effectively using multiple tools, including both high and low/no technology options
    • develop self-regulation and self-assessment skills
    • sustain effort and persistence
    • increase autonomy
    • show what they know through flexible, individualized assessment options

    PRACTICAL MATERIALS: Diverse examples of successfully using UDL across grades, sample assignments and activity ideas, and helpful tips and personal reflections from teachers and administrators.
